SIVR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2025 in Review

277 of the 7,620 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in abrdn Physical Silver Shares ETF (SIVR) for Q3 2025, worth a combined $1.03B — up 85% from $553M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 60 funds opened new SIVR positions and 13 closed out — a net gain of 47 holders — while 95 added to existing stakes and 59 trimmed.

The largest buyer was JP Morgan Chase, adding an estimated $159M. The largest seller was Quadrature Capital, cutting an estimated $9.27M.
